Transaction fd3f27d76ceba01e3626af6063faf56d1924163b1253768aeb9d889f41a74696

178 Input
2 Outputs
  • fd3f27d76ceba01e3626af6063faf56d1924163b1253768aeb9d889f41a74696:0
  • value  1034354
    address  3NHaXude82oNbjys6H6W7DEwGiPvEgzrHZ
  • fd3f27d76ceba01e3626af6063faf56d1924163b1253768aeb9d889f41a74696:1
  • value  468963790
    address  3EVrj9umsp14fQoywNuCZVfHx4RQ6nRgPB